Hello, I am considering Skegness Grammar for my DD aged 16 who will begin year 12 in September. She would be a boarder. I am not concerned about boarding because she has spent two years at a different state boarding school in the north and settled well. Does anyone have experience or knowledge of SGS that they could share please? Especially useful from those who have experience of boarding. The alternative to SGS is Ripon Grammar, not sure how the two compare. Thanks.

Don't have any experience, but looking at the performance data I would pick Ripon Grammar.
The SGS average A-level grade is only average.
I know it's passed but GCSE progress for prior high attainers is also average at best.

I too have no personal experience but echo stubiff's concerns. High achievers at Skegness gain an average of a B grade at GCSE, that is pretty poor for a grammar. All the comprehensives near me either meet or do better than that.
